form 数据将0,1转换为文字的4种方式
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
form 数据将0,1转换为文字的4种方式《form 数据将0,1转换为文字的4种方式》
1. 简介
在现代数据处理和分析中,经常会遇到将0和1表示的数据转换成文字的情况。
这种转换可以帮助我们更好地理解和解释数据的含义,同时也让数据更具可视化和直观性。
在本文中,我们将探讨四种常见的方式来实现这种转换,并分析它们各自的优缺点。
2. 直接替换
我们可以采用最简单直接的方式来实现数据的转换,即通过直接替换0和1为指定的文字。
将0替换成“否”、“未”或者“关闭”,将1替换成“是”、“已”或者“开启”。
这种方式简单直接,易于理解和实现,但缺点是对数据的含义可能进行了无意义的赋予,同时不利于后续的数据分析和挖掘。
3. 条件语句
另一种方式是借助条件语句来实现数据的转换。
我们可以编写简单的if-else语句来根据0和1的取值来确定相应的文字。
这种方式更加灵活,可以根据具体的业务逻辑来进行转换,并且可以应用多个条件进行排他性的转换。
然而,当数据的取值较多时,这种方式可能显得冗
长和复杂,不利于代码的维护和理解。
4. 数据映射
我们还可以通过建立数据映射来实现数据的转换。
我们可以建立一个
映射表,将0和1分别映射到相应的文字上。
这种方式可以将转换的
逻辑单独抽离出来,使得代码更加清晰和易于维护,同时也方便对映
射表进行修改和扩展。
然而,需要注意的是,当映射的数据量较大时,映射表的维护可能会成为一个问题。
5. 使用枚举类型
最后一种方式是利用编程语言中的枚举类型来实现数据的转换。
我们
可以定义一个枚举类型,将0和1分别对应到枚举类型的两个取值上,然后通过枚举类型来获取相应的文字。
这种方式在保证了代码的清晰
和可维护性的也能很好地避免了数据映射表的维护问题。
但需要注意
的是,并非所有的编程语言都支持枚举类型,因此需要根据具体的情
况来选择。
6. 总结
将0和1表示的数据转换为文字是数据处理和分析中的常见问题。
针
对不同的场景和需求,我们可以采用不同的方式来实现这种转换。
直
接替换简单直接,条件语句灵活多变,数据映射易于维护,枚举类型
清晰明了。
在实际应用中,需要根据具体情况和需求选择最合适的方
式来进行实现。
7. 个人观点
在实际的数据处理和分析中,我更倾向于使用数据映射的方式来实现
数据的转换。
数据映射将转换逻辑与业务逻辑分离,使得代码更加清
晰和易于维护。
通过良好的映射表设计,可以很好地应对数据量的增
长和变化,使得转换逻辑更加灵活和可扩展。
以上就是对于"form 数据将0,1转换为文字的4种方式"这一主题的探讨和总结。
希望通过本文的介绍,你能够更深入地理解这一问题,并
在实际应用中选择合适的方式来进行数据转换。
数据处理和分析在现
代社会中扮演着非常重要的角色。
尤其是对于大数据领域来说,数据
的处理和分析是必不可少的。
而在这个过程中,经常会遇到将0和1
表示的数据转换成文字的情况。
这种转换可以帮助我们更好地理解和
解释数据的含义,同时也让数据更具可视化和直观性。
在本文中,我
们将继续详细探讨四种常见的方式来实现这种转换,并分析它们各自
的优缺点。
直接替换
我们再次回顾一下最简单直接的方式:通过直接替换0和1为指定的
文字。
将0替换成“否”、“未”或者“关闭”,将1替换成“是”、“已”或者“开启”。
这种方式简单直接,易于理解和实现,但缺点
是对数据的含义可能进行了无意义的赋予,同时不利于后续的数据分
析和挖掘。
条件语句
另一种方式是借助条件语句来实现数据的转换。
我们可以编写简单的
if-else语句来根据0和1的取值来确定相应的文字。
这种方式更加灵活,可以根据具体的业务逻辑来进行转换,并且可以应用多个条件进
行排他性的转换。
然而,当数据的取值较多时,这种方式可能显得冗
长和复杂,不利于代码的维护和理解。
数据映射
我们还可以通过建立数据映射来实现数据的转换。
我们可以建立一个
映射表,将0和1分别映射到相应的文字上。
这种方式可以将转换的
逻辑单独抽离出来,使得代码更加清晰和易于维护,同时也方便对映
射表进行修改和扩展。
然而,需要注意的是,当映射的数据量较大时,映射表的维护可能会成为一个问题。
使用枚举类型
最后一种方式是利用编程语言中的枚举类型来实现数据的转换。
我们
可以定义一个枚举类型,将0和1分别对应到枚举类型的两个取值上,然后通过枚举类型来获取相应的文字。
这种方式在保证了代码的清晰
和可维护性的也能很好地避免了数据映射表的维护问题。
但需要注意
的是,并非所有的编程语言都支持枚举类型,因此需要根据具体的情
况来选择。
在数据处理和分析中,选择合适的方式来进行数据转换非常重要。
每种方式都有其优缺点,需要根据具体的情况来进行权衡和选择。
无论选择哪种方式,在实际应用中都需要进行充分的测试和验证,确保转换的准确性和稳定性。
结论
将0和1表示的数据转换为文字是数据处理和分析中的常见问题。
针对不同的场景和需求,我们可以采用不同的方式来实现这种转换。
直接替换简单直接,条件语句灵活多变,数据映射易于维护,枚举类型清晰明了。
在实际应用中,需要根据具体情况和需求选择最合适的方式来进行实现。
个人观点
在实际的数据处理和分析中,我更倾向于使用数据映射的方式来实现数据的转换。
数据映射将转换逻辑与业务逻辑分离,使得代码更加清晰和易于维护。
通过良好的映射表设计,可以很好地应对数据量的增长和变化,使得转换逻辑更加灵活和可扩展。
希望通过本文的介绍,你能够更深入地理解这一问题,并在实际应用中选择合适的方式来进行数据转换。
数据处理和分析是一个持续学习和探索的过程,希望我们能够在这个过程中不断进步。